GENERAL TIPS FOR AN ACCURATE MEASUREMENT
Cooling lamp: The instrument waits for the lamp to cool down.
Battery low: The battery must be replaced soon.
Dead battery: This indicates that the battery is dead and must
be replaced. Once this indication is displayed, normal operation
of the instrument will be interrupted. Change the battery and
restart the meter.
The instructions listed below should be carefully followed during testing to ensure best accuracy.
Color or suspended matter in large amounts may cause
interference, therefore these should be removed by
treatment with active carbon and by prior filtration.
For a correct filling of the cuvette: the liquid in the
cuvette forms a concavity on the top; the bottom of this
concavity must be at the same level of the 10 mL mark.
Proper use of the powder reagent packet:
(a) use scissors to open the powder packet;
(b) push the edges of the packet to form a spout;
(c) pour out the content of the packet.
Proper use of dropper:
(a) to get good reproducible results, tap the dropper on the table for several times and wipe
the outside of the dropper with a cloth.
(b) always keep the dropper bottle in a vertical position while dosing the reagent.
